Output 7002e388995183d0f81c9e2e4d39d67df4e434fc72c3c3a1431a856445f7f3b2:1

value
73744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72ccac2fd27752cf25c422759d9ae8894926f49f OP_EQUAL
address
3CA29KBaWcy76Vh97d2DCdZNsBmBhSXX31
transaction
7002e388995183d0f81c9e2e4d39d67df4e434fc72c3c3a1431a856445f7f3b2
confirmations
218890
spent
true